自定义博客皮肤

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

yac

Yaconf – 一个高性能的配置管理扩展 本文地址:http://www.laruence.com/2015/06/12/3051.html 这个项目其实不是我新的idea, 这个是我在来微博以后, 第一个优化项目中顺手做的一个小工具, 本身叫做Weibo_Conf. 但是因为Weibo_Co...

2019-03-20 17:29:20

阅读数 202

评论数 0

访问一个URL经历了哪些过程

从大致上来讲经历了 客户端获取URL - > DNS解析 - > TCP连接 - >发送HTTP请求 - >服务器处理请求 - >返回报文 - >浏览器解析渲染页面...

2018-11-26 18:03:21

阅读数 128

评论数 0

网络协议六

不同的局域网之间通信需要网关。 静态路由:每个网段都有自己的规则,在路由器中进行保存。 转发网关和net网关 欧洲十国游(转发网关):路由器内根据一定的规则进行转发。mac进行改变,但是IP不会改变。IP在各个里面是不同的。 玄奘西行:源IP和目标IP相同,在国际上有公共接口。源IP和目标...

2018-09-27 11:52:53

阅读数 48

评论数 0

四种隔离级别

数据库事务的隔离级别有4种,由低到高分别为Read uncommitted 、Read committed 、Repeatable read 、Serializable 。而且,在事务的并发操作中可能会出现脏读,不可重复读,幻读。下面通过事例一一阐述它们的概念与联系。 Read uncommit...

2018-09-27 10:36:36

阅读数 61

评论数 0

elasticsearch3

document路由算法:shard=hash(routing)%number_of_primary_shards 默认情况下routing默认使用的是_id,也可以在发送请求的时候手动指定(routing value),对应用级别的负载均衡是很有帮助的,对id值进行hash。 document...

2018-09-26 19:01:32

阅读数 69

评论数 0

elasticsearch2

三种元数据 1、_index元数据 (1)代表一个document存放在哪个index中 (2)类似的数据放在一个索引,非类似的数据放不同索引:product index(包含了所有的商品),sales index(包含了所有的商品销售数据),inventory index(包含了所有库存相关...

2018-09-25 10:47:24

阅读数 130

评论数 0

elasticsearch1

es的特点: 自动的维护数据的分布到多个节点索引的建立,还有搜索请求到多个节点的执行; 自动维护数据的冗余副本,保证说,一些机器宕机了,不会丢失任何数据; 封装了更多的高级功能,以给我们提供更多的高级的支持,让我们快速的开发应用,开发更多的复杂的应用:复杂的搜索功能,聚合分析的功能,基于地理...

2018-09-23 10:14:26

阅读数 58

评论数 0

PHP中的特殊的函数

 array_reduce(array,myfunction,initial)   发送数组中的每个值到用户自定义的函数,然后进行函数处理,其中第三个参数代表了处理函数的第一次调用的第一个参数,以后第一个参数就会以上一次调用的返回结果为标准进行方法的调用。 preg_replace_callba...

2018-09-21 10:35:56

阅读数 83

评论数 0

es集群的简单理解

在我的理解es集群和redis集群在一定程度上是非常想象的,推荐看一下redis设计与实现,挺有帮助的 个人es的体会: es在分配索引的时候就已经指定了主分片的个数,竹节丝安确定以后不会在进行更改;  一个集群中可以有多个节点,但有一个主节点,每个节点可以放不同的分片,每个分片,包括主分片...

2018-09-21 10:18:26

阅读数 2393

评论数 0

PHP

转载: http://www.cnblogs.com/sweng php中容器的理解: 我们先实现一个容器类 1 2 3 4 5 6 7 8 9 class Container{     p...

2018-09-20 10:35:18

阅读数 73

评论数 0

shell脚本

shell教程,不错的选择

2018-09-20 10:26:47

阅读数 87

评论数 0

mac下navicat的激活

需要的资源、工具 ④Mac版 Navicat Premium 12 v12.0.22.0 官网下载地址: 英文64位 http://download.navicat.com/download/navicat120_premium_en.dmg 中文简体64位 http://dow...

2018-09-13 11:09:43

阅读数 2758

评论数 0

网络协议——tcp和udp

建立连接:是为了在客户端和服务端维护连接,而建立一定的数据结构来维护双方交互的状态,用这样的数据结构来保证所谓的面向连接的特性。 TCP:提供可交付。通过tcp连接传输的数据,无差错,不丢失,不重复,并且按序到达。发送的是流。拥塞控制,有状态有服务。 UDP:不保证不丢失,不保证按序。基于数据...

2018-09-12 18:53:52

阅读数 159

评论数 0

网络协议六

动态路由算法: 第一种:距离矢量算法每个路由都保存着一个路由表,表里面的信息:到目的路由其从哪走,以及到目的路由器的距离; 缺点:1.当一个路由挂掉的时候不能及时得出来,只能试了所有的路由之后才能得出来; 2。每次发送的时候发送的是整个全局路由表。 第二种:链路状态路由:通过每个路由将自己...

2018-09-11 19:44:11

阅读数 128

评论数 0

网络协议五——ping的工作原理

ping是通过ICMP进行工作的(控制报文协议),封装在ip包里面。 ping中包含的信息:类型字段:对于请求数据包来说该字段为8,顺序号:为了记录连续发送的多个ping的顺序,还有一个时间标识用于判断ping是否超时。 查询报文类型(ping) 还有一种是差错报文(traceroute...

2018-09-07 17:49:51

阅读数 277

评论数 0

kafka的特点

  一个topic中有可以有多个分区。如上图: 每个分区中保存的消息都是有序的,在每个分区中都有一个offset,在comsume中维护offset。 分区中的消息不会像其他消息队列一样消息完就丢失,而是将其保存,在指定的过期时间点内进行丢弃。 分区的特点:首先这使得每个日志的数量不会...

2018-09-07 15:40:28

阅读数 596

评论数 0

kafka

一、基本概念 介绍 Kafka是一个分布式的、可分区的、可复制的消息系统。它提供了普通消息系统的功能,但具有自己独特的设计。 这个独特的设计是什么样的呢? 首先让我们看几个基本的消息系统术语: Kafka将消息以topic为单位进行归纳。 将向Kafka topic发布消息的程序成为produce...

2018-09-07 15:10:56

阅读数 104

评论数 0

网络协议四——交换机

mac(多媒体访问控制)其作用就是在数据链路层利用多路访问解决在网络中谁先发谁后发的问题。 发给谁,谁接受:利用链路层地址,因为在mac层我们记录了源mac地址和目标mac地址,对上游的包进行层层包装,然后在服务端进行层层拆开取得数据内容交给服务器去处理。处理结束后返回一个响应; 数据怎么容错...

2018-09-05 15:18:46

阅读数 506

评论数 0

vim基础命令

1、移动指令 指令 功能 简介 编者按 k/j/h/l 上下左右移动光标 一般模式下,可以使用【k/j/h/l】代替方向键上下左右移动光标,多次相同移动指令可使用数字+指令执行,如【30j】即代表向下移动光标30次; 刚开始使用这四个键会很难记、很不适应,...

2018-09-05 09:54:40

阅读数 90

评论数 0

索引

聚集索引和非聚集索引的特点: 1、聚集索引。表数据按照索引的顺序来存储的,也就是说索引项的顺序与表中记录的物理顺序一致。对于聚集索引,叶子结点即存储了真实的数据行,不再有另外单独的数据页。 在一张表上最多只能创建一个聚集索引,因为真实数据的物理顺序只能有一种。 2、非聚集索引。表数据存储顺序与...

2018-09-04 22:45:33

阅读数 64

评论数 0

提示
确定要删除当前文章?
取消 删除